    I found this Colombian bakery through Yelp when I was on a trip to South Florida. We were looking for Colombian breakfast and this place was nearby our location. When I first walked in I loved the decor of the restaurant. It had a warm and modern feeling with wood panels and an open space. I was expecting a more traditional take on Colombian breakfast but it was a more elevated offering. For example they had pan de bono waffles and other spin in traditional dishes. The food was good and I'll give it another try if I'm in the area again. The coffee was great too. I saw they also offer lunch and dinner and the dishes on the menu looked good. Service was great. Our waitress kept checking on us and made us feel welcomed.
